Ingredients

  • 140 g (1 cup) plain flour
  • 70 g (1/3 cup) caster sugar
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• ¼ tsp salt
  • 125 ml (1/2 cup) buttermilk
  • 1 egg
  • 2 tbsp melted butter cooled
  • 2 tbsp orange juice
  • 0.25 tsp orange zest
  • For the cinnamon sugar
  • 125 g (4.4oz) granulated sugar
  • 1 tsp cinnamon
  • 75 g (2.6oz) melted butter

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to fan assisted 160C / 180C / 350F / gas 4 and lightly oil two 6 cup doughnut tins.
  2. Mix together the flour, sugar, baking powder and salt in a large bowl and set aside.
  3. In another bowl, combine the buttermilk, eggs, melted butter, orange juice and orange zest.
  4. Mix the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and stir until everything is just combined.
  5. Using a spoon, add the batter in to 8 doughnut cups until they are three quarters full.
  6. Bake the doughnuts for 13-15 mins until a toothpick comes out clean, remove them from the oven and let them cool in the pan before transferring them to wire rack to cool completely.
  7. Mix together the sugar and cinnamon in a bowl. Dip the donuts in the melted butter, let the excess butter drip off before dipping in the cinnamon sugar till they are well coated.
